History
| 1971 | Imported highly fluidized chemical admixture (Mol Master) and began to sell it. |
|---|---|
| 1973 | Developed the first premixed mortar (High-Mol) in the world and began to manufacture and sell it. Began to manufacture and sell mortar adhesion enhancer (High-Mol Emulsion). |
| 1977 | Established Showa Denko Kenzai K.K. with 100% capital invested by Showa Denko K.K. |
| 1981 | Began to manufacture and sell fire resistive dual pipes (Keipla Pipes). |
| 1985 | Shifted the control of manufacturing Keipla Pipes to Kanose Denko K.K. (today's Niigata Showa K.K.). |
| 2009 | Relocated the head office from Hamamatsu-cho, Minato-ku, Tokyo to Ebisu-cho, Kanagawa-ku, Yokohama, Kanagawa |
| 2012 | Began to manufacture and sell "SHOWA (((Shaon))) FDP"* *Sound insulation is called “Shaon” in Japanese. |
| 2015 | Completed a new mortar plant in Ishioka Plant. Transferred “Lambda” business to Konoshima Chemical Co., Ltd. |
| 2016 | Completed a new plant for “HATOCOT” (Rooftop multipurpose piping unit) in Ishioka Plant. |
